Dhaula Population - Muktsar, Punjab

Dhaula is a medium size village located in Gidderbaha Tehsil of Muktsar district, Punjab with total 261 families residing. The Dhaula village has population of 1362 of which 731 are males while 631 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Dhaula village population of children with age 0-6 is 135 which makes up 9.91 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Dhaula village is 863 which is lower than Punjab state average of 895. Child Sex Ratio for the Dhaula as per census is 875, higher than Punjab average of 846.

Dhaula village has lower literacy rate compared to Punjab. In 2011, literacy rate of Dhaula village was 59.25 % compared to 75.84 % of Punjab. In Dhaula Male literacy stands at 68.59 % while female literacy rate was 48.42 %.

Caste Factor

In Dhaula village, most of the villagers are from Schedule Caste (SC).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 48.38 % of total population in Dhaula village. The village Dhaula curr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Dhaula village out of total population, 591 were engaged in work activities. 79.70 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 20.30 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 591 workers engaged in Main Work, 167 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 173 were Agricultural labourer.
